POSITION SUMMARY:The core responsibility of the Maintenance Parts Clerk is to support the maintenance department by ensuring maintenance parts, supplies, and inventory are properly ordered, received, organized, stocked, and readily available to support equipment repairs and preventative maintenance activities. This position works closely with the Maintenance Manager, Maintenance Supervisor, Maintenance Planner, Maintenance Technicians, Production, and suppliers to maintain accurate inventory levels, minimize downtime, and ensure parts are available when needed.
The Maintenance Parts Clerk is also responsible for maintaining organized parts storage areas, tracking inventory usage, processing orders, and assisting with cost control.

- Order maintenance parts, supplies, tools, and equipment from vendors including McMaster-Carr, Grainger, OEM suppliers, and other approved suppliers.
- Maintain accurate inventory counts and ensure appropriate stock levels of critical maintenance parts and supplies.
- Receive, inspect, label, and properly store incoming maintenance parts and materials.
- Organize and maintain the maintenance parts room to ensure items are clearly identified, accessible, and properly stored.
- Monitor inventory usage and identify parts that need to be reordered based on established minimum and maximum stock levels.
- Maintain accurate records of parts received, issued, returned, and on order.
- Assist the Maintenance Manager, Maintenance Supervisor, Maintenance Planner, and Maintenance Technicians, in identifying and sourcing parts needed for repairs and preventative maintenance work orders.
- Research parts, pricing, availability, lead times, and alternative products to support cost-effective purchasing decisions.
- Coordinate with suppliers regarding order status, backorders, delivery dates, incorrect shipments, and damaged materials.
- Assist with maintaining accurate vendor information, pricing, and part numbers within the ERP or maintenance management system.
- Support the maintenance department by ensuring commonly used and critical parts are available to minimize equipment downtime.
- Manage parts inventory and purchasing costs in accordance with established department budgets.
- Properly dispose of or return obsolete, damaged, or excess parts as directed by the Maintenance Manager.
- Maintain organized documentation and records related to maintenance parts, purchasing, and inventory.
- Support compliance with OSHA, SQF, food safety, and other applicable regulatory standards.
- Collaborate with the Maintenance Manager and Production Supervisor to ensure parts are available to support preventative maintenance and repair activities.
- Maintain a clean, safe, and organized maintenance parts storage area.
